综合大数据分析系统有哪些
-
综合大数据分析系统是一个集成了多种功能和工具的平台,用于帮助用户收集、存储、处理、分析和可视化大数据。以下是综合大数据分析系统可能具备的功能和特点:
-
数据采集和清洗:综合大数据分析系统通常具备数据采集和清洗功能,可以从多个来源获取数据,包括数据库、日志文件、传感器等,然后对数据进行清洗和预处理,以确保数据的质量和一致性。
-
数据存储和管理:综合大数据分析系统通常集成了数据存储和管理功能,可以支持多种存储方式,包括关系型数据库、NoSQL数据库、分布式文件系统等,以便存储大规模的数据,并能够对数据进行高效的管理和检索。
-
数据处理和分析:综合大数据分析系统通常包含数据处理和分析工具,可以进行数据挖掘、机器学习、统计分析等多种分析任务,帮助用户发现数据中的模式、趋势和规律,并提供预测和决策支持。
-
可视化和报告:综合大数据分析系统通常提供数据可视化和报告功能,可以将分析结果以图表、报表等形式直观展示,帮助用户更直观地理解数据,并向决策者传达分析结果。
-
安全和隐私保护:综合大数据分析系统通常具备安全和隐私保护机制,包括数据加密、访问控制、审计跟踪等功能,以确保数据在采集、存储、处理和传输过程中的安全性和隐私性。
综合大数据分析系统的功能和特点可以根据用户需求和场景的不同而有所差异,但通常都致力于帮助用户更有效地利用大数据进行分析和决策。通过综合大数据分析系统,用户可以更快速地获取有价值的信息,发现隐藏在数据中的洞察,并做出更明智的决策。
1年前 -
-
综合大数据分析系统是指可以处理多种类型数据并进行综合分析的系统。这样的系统通常包括数据收集、存储、处理、分析和可视化等功能模块,能够帮助用户从海量数据中发现信息、洞察趋势、做出决策。下面将介绍几种常见的综合大数据分析系统:
-
Hadoop
Hadoop是最流行的开源大数据分析系统之一,由Apache开发。它基于分布式计算和存储的思想,采用HDFS(Hadoop Distributed File System)来存储数据,通过MapReduce等计算框架实现数据处理和分析。Hadoop生态系统还包括了许多相关的项目,如Hive、Spark、HBase等,可以满足不同类型的数据处理需求。 -
Spark
Spark是一种快速、通用的大数据处理引擎,支持内存计算,比传统的MapReduce计算速度更快。Spark提供了丰富的API,包括Spark SQL、Spark Streaming、MLlib(机器学习库)等模块,能够满足多种数据处理和分析需求。 -
Kafka
Kafka是一个分布式流处理平台,用于处理实时数据流。它具有高吞吐量、低延迟等特点,可以帮助用户实时监控和分析数据。Kafka可以与Hadoop、Spark等系统集成,实现数据的实时处理和分析。 -
Elasticsearch
Elasticsearch是一个开源的分布式搜索和分析引擎,可以快速检索大量数据并进行复杂的分析。它支持全文搜索、结构化搜索、实时搜索等功能,适用于日志分析、监控、安全分析等场景。 -
Tableau
Tableau是一种流行的数据可视化工具,可以连接各种数据源,并快速创建交互式的数据可视化报表。用户可以通过Tableau实现数据的探索、分析和展示,帮助他们更好地理解数据、发现见解。
综合大数据分析系统的选择应根据具体的业务需求和数据特点来确定,可以根据数据规模、实时性要求、分析复杂度等因素来选择适合的系统或工具。同时,不同系统之间也可以进行集成,构建一个更完整的大数据分析平台。
1年前 -
-
综合大数据分析系统是指集成了多种功能的大数据分析平台,能够支持大规模数据的存储、处理、分析和可视化。这类系统通常包括数据采集、数据存储、数据处理、数据分析和可视化等模块,提供了全方位的数据处理和分析功能。下面将从方法、操作流程等方面介绍综合大数据分析系统。
方法
-
数据采集:综合大数据分析系统首先需要从不同的数据源中采集数据。数据源可以包括传感器、日志文件、数据库、互联网等。采集数据的方法包括实时流式数据采集和批量数据采集。实时数据采集可以通过消息队列、流式处理引擎等技术来实现,批量数据采集则可以通过ETL工具等方式来完成。
-
数据存储:采集到的数据需要存储在系统中,以便后续的处理和分析。常用的数据存储技术包括关系型数据库、NoSQL数据库、分布式文件系统等。综合大数据分析系统通常会选择适合大规模数据存储和处理的技术,如Hadoop、Spark等。
-
数据处理:数据处理是综合大数据分析系统的核心部分。数据处理包括数据清洗、数据转换、数据聚合、数据计算等操作。数据处理的方法可以包括MapReduce、Spark、Flink等技术,通过这些技术可以对大规模数据进行高效处理。
-
数据分析:数据分析是综合大数据分析系统的重要功能,通过数据分析可以发现数据中的规律和洞察。数据分析通常包括统计分析、机器学习、数据挖掘等方法。综合大数据分析系统通常会提供各种数据分析工具和算法库,方便用户进行数据分析。
-
可视化:数据可视化是将数据以图表、图形等形式展示出来,使用户能够直观地理解数据。综合大数据分析系统通常会提供数据可视化工具,用户可以通过这些工具创建各种图表和报表,实现数据的可视化展示。
操作流程
-
数据采集:首先需要配置数据源,选择合适的数据采集方法,将数据采集到系统中。
-
数据存储:将采集到的数据存储在系统中,选择合适的数据存储技术,建立数据存储结构。
-
数据处理:对存储在系统中的数据进行处理,包括清洗、转换、聚合、计算等操作。可以使用MapReduce、Spark等技术进行数据处理。
-
数据分析:对处理后的数据进行分析,发现数据中的规律和洞察。可以使用统计分析、机器学习等方法进行数据分析。
-
数据可视化:将分析得到的结果以图表、图形等形式展示出来,实现数据的可视化展示。用户可以通过可视化工具创建各种图表和报表。
综合大数据分析系统通过以上方法和操作流程,可以实现大规模数据的存储、处理、分析和可视化,帮助用户更好地理解和利用数据。
1年前 -


